Berserk Film Tour Sends Fans to France's Château de Pierrefonds

posted on by Sarah Nelkin
Participants in 6-day tour to visit fortress built in 1393 filled with ballistas, armor

In celebration of the upcoming Berserk Ōgon Jidai-Hen III: Kōrin movie, a tour to the Château de Pierrefonds castle is being held in collaboration with the Japanese tourism agency, “Sora no Tabi” (Adventures in the Sky). The 6-day tour is titled “Visiting the Middle-Age French Fortress! 6 DAYS with Château de Pierrefonds and Paris”. The main destination of the trip is the Château de Pierrefonds, a fortress built in 1393 with historical importance that has been compared to the Palace of Versailles and the Louvre Museum. It is well-known as a stage for many films and TV shows, such as Disney's Wizards of Waverly Place. Inside the castle are ballistas, armor, and iron masks, as well as a room that was once used as a dungeon. The reason this place was chosen in relation to Berserk is because it gives the same dark fantasy feeling as the series.

Tours will be departing every day from January until April. Those who participate in the tour will receive a special Berserk pamphlet not for sale that was only available to the media, and those who participate as a couple will receive a present of macaroons from one of Paris's famous stores. Those who sign up for the tour before February 1 will also get a ticket for the Berserk Ōgon Jidai-Hen III: Kōrin movie. Further details can be confirmed at the Sora no Tabi website, and prices vary depending on date.

The third movie in the trilogy based off of Kentarō Miura's manga will open in theaters in Japan on February 1.
